See License.txt in the project root for license information. *--------------------------------------------------------------------------------------------*/ Object.defineProperty(exports, "__esModule", { value: true }); const UserAgentError_1 = require("../UserAgentError"); const JwsToken_1 = require("../crypto/protocols/jose/jws/JwsToken"); /** * Class that represents a ClaimObject * @class */ class ClaimObject { /** * Instantiates a new ClaimObject. * @param claimClass Pointer to the claimClass that is tied to this claimObject. * @param claimDescriptions A list of claim descriptions that will define each claim. * @param claimDetails A list of claims that are contained in this claimObject. */ constructor(claimClass, context, type, issuer, claimDescriptions, claimDetails, signedClaimDetails) { this.claimClass = claimClass; this.issuer = issuer; this.claimDescriptions = claimDescriptions; this.claimDetails = claimDetails; this.signedClaimDetails = signedClaimDetails; this.context = context; this.type = type; } /** * Sign the claim details with signer. * @param signer Identifier that will sign the claim details. */ async signClaimDetails(signer, keyReference) { if (signer.id !== this.issuer) { throw new UserAgentError_1.default(`Signer ID: ${signer.id} does not match issuer ID: ${this.issuer}`); } this.signedClaimDetails = await signer.sign(this.claimDetails, keyReference); console.log(`${signer.id} signed claim details`); } /** * If details are signed, return signed claim details. * Else return unsigned claim details. */ getClaimDetails() { if (this.signedClaimDetails) { return this.signedClaimDetails; } return this.claimDetails; } /** * Add a claim to the claim details. * @param {Claim} claim Claim to be added to claimDetails. * @param {ClaimDescription} claimDescription Optional parameter if want to also add a corresponding claim description. */ async addClaim(claim, claimDescription) { this.claimDetails.push(claim); if (claimDescription) { this.claimDescriptions.push(claimDescription); } } /** * Stringify ClaimObject. * @returns A Stringified ClaimObject in the correct format */ serialize() { let claimDetails = {}; if (this.signedClaimDetails) { claimDetails = { type: 'jws', data: this.signedClaimDetails }; } else { claimDetails = { type: 'unsigned', data: this.claimDetails }; } const claimObject = { claimClass: this.claimClass, '@context': this.context, '@type': this.type, claimDescriptions: this.claimDescriptions, claimIssuer: this.issuer, claimDetails }; return JSON.stringify(claimObject); } /** * Create new ClaimObject from stringified JSON. * @param object Stringifed JSON object * @returns a ClaimObject */ static async deserialize(object) { let claimObject; if (typeof (object) === 'string') { claimObject = JSON.parse(object); } else { claimObject = object; } if (!claimObject.claimDetails) { throw new UserAgentError_1.default(`Claim Object does not contain parameter claimDetails`); } if (!claimObject.claimClass) { throw new UserAgentError_1.default(`Claim Object does not contain parameter claimClass`); } if (!claimObject.claimDescriptions) { throw new UserAgentError_1.default(`Claim Object does not contain parameter claimDescriptions`); } if (!claimObject.claimIssuer) { throw new UserAgentError_1.default(`Claim Object does not contain parameter claimIssuer`); } if (!claimObject['@context'] || !claimObject['@type']) { throw new UserAgentError_1.default(`Claim Object is missing context`); } const claimDetails = claimObject.claimDetails; if (claimDetails.type === 'unsigned') { return new ClaimObject(claimObject.claimClass, claimObject['@context'], claimObject['@type'], claimObject.claimIssuer, claimObject.claimDescriptions, claimDetails.data); } else { const token = await JwsToken_1.default.deserialize(claimDetails.data); const parsedClaimDetails = JSON.parse(token.payload.toString()); return new ClaimObject(claimObject.claimClass, claimObject['@context'], claimObject['@type'], claimObject.claimIssuer, claimObject.claimDescriptions, parsedClaimDetails, claimDetails.data); } } } exports.default = ClaimObject; //# sourceMappingURL=ClaimObject.js.map
